Wages up 0.1 per cent in manufacturing
Preliminary figures for average basic salaries for full-time employees in manufacturing show a 0.1 per cent increase between the 3rd quarter of 2016 and the 4th quarter of 2016.

Preliminary figures for the wage index show a 0.6 per cent increase in average basic salaries for the 4th quarter of 2016 in oil and gas extraction and mining, and a 1.1 per cent increase in transport in the same period.
